Define Your Lawn Care Goals for Achievement
To complete a effective landscape, homeowners must first define their landscaping goals clearly. This step acts as a foundational element in the planning process, guiding decisions and ensuring alignment with personal preferences. Homeowners should consider factors such as functionality, aesthetics, and maintenance needs. For instance, they may want an outdoor space that enables family gatherings, promotes relaxation, or improves curb appeal.
Moreover, it is vital to examine the present landscape. Grasping sun exposure, soil makeup, and water drainage will better define goals and direct choices. Homeowners might focus on environmental responsibility, picking native plants or water-efficient designs.
Select Garden Plants for Your Region
Picking garden vegetation that are suited to the local climate is vital for establishing a flourishing outdoor space. Choosing the right plants can bring about lower maintenance and healthier growth, maximizing water usage and reducing the need for chemical treatments.
Gardeners should research their local hardiness zone, as this determines which plants are likely to survive seasonal temperature fluctuations.
Native plants typically present the best choice, as they are designed for the local environment and necessitate less care. Also, reviewing factors such as soil type, sunlight exposure, and rainfall patterns will facilitate in making informed decisions.
Uniting a assortment of perennials and annuals can produce perpetual appeal while making certain that plants blossom at different times.
Ultimately, recognizing the regional climate patterns and choosing fitting plants will lead to a vibrant and sustainable landscape that elevates the dwelling's complete aesthetic value.
Construct Effective and Beautiful Paths
Establishing functional and beautiful walkways improves both the aesthetic and usability of exterior areas. Thoughtfully designed trails navigate guests through landscaped areas, adding structure while ensuring ease of movement.
You can choose various materials, like gravel, pavers, and natural stone, to harmonize with the surrounding landscape and architecture.
Using curved designs and variable widths can produce visual interest and encourage exploration. Additionally, adequate drainage and care are vital to guarantee pathways remain secure and visually pleasing over time.
Using low-maintenance ground cover next to paths can ease rigid edges, while intentionally placed illumination can strengthen security and highlight the beauty of the surrounding environment.
In the end, strategically positioned pathways not only offer a useful function but also enhance the overall beauty of garden areas, creating them more delightful and inviting for all visitors who visit.
Incorporate Hardscaping into Garden design
While softscaping often receives recognition for its bright hues and visual appeal, incorporating hardscape features is equally essential for a comprehensive landscape design. Hardscaping elements, such as patios, walkways, retaining walls, and decks, offer structure and functionality to outdoor spaces. These features not only establish zones but also improve ease of access and functionality.
Incorporating stone, brick, or concrete can create aesthetic interest and complement the adjacent greenery. Thoughtfully designed hardscaping can guide the movement flow while delivering practical approaches for drainage and erosion control.
Additionally, it creates a balanced aesthetic, juxtaposing the natural shapes of plants with the geometric lines of hard surfaces. Ultimately, the integration of hardscaping serves to unify various components of a landscape, creating a cohesive environment that is both attractive and functional, enabling homeowners to appreciate their outdoor spaces to the fullest.

Use Lighting to Improve Your External Ambiance
Transforming outdoor spaces with strategic lighting can significantly enhance their ambiance and usability. Thoughtfully placed lights establish welcoming environments, making gardens, patios, and walkways more appealing after sunset.
Soft, warm lighting can establish a cozy environment, suitable for comfort, while brighter fixtures can illuminate architectural features and focal points.
Using various kinds of lighting, like string lights, lanterns, or spotlights, facilitates creative flexibility and innovation. Pathway lights offer safety and guidance, while uplighting can emphasize trees and shrubs, creating depth to the landscape.
Arranging light fixtures at multiple levels helps establish visual appeal. Also, dimmers and timers can change the atmosphere according to the event, enabling you to move from casual gatherings to intimate dinners.
Preserve Your Landscape to Guarantee Enduring Beauty
Keeping a landscape in good condition requires regular attention and care to maintain its visual appeal and strength. Routine tasks, including mowing, pruning, and weeding, serve an vital function in controlling excessive development and ensuring plant health.
Seasonal clean-ups including leaf removal and mulching strengthen aesthetic appeal while protecting the soil.
Proper irrigation methods are essential; deep, sporadic irrigation encourages root growth and drought resilience. Nutrient application, customized for specific plant needs, supplies necessary nutrients, fostering vibrant blooms and lush greenery.
In addition, pest management should be preventative, leveraging natural methods where possible to curtail chemical use.
Routine evaluations for evidence of sickness or wear can avoid small issues from intensifying. By incorporating these maintenance strategies, homeowners can enjoy a landscape that not only looks gorgeous but also thrives over time.

What Is the Average Price of Expert Landscaping Work?
Professional lawn care typically costs between $1,500 and $5,000 for basic installations, depending on elements like size, design complexity, and material selection. Higher-end projects can exceed $10,000, showcasing intricate designs and premium materials.
Which Periods Are Best Suited for Outdoor Design Work?
The top windows for outdoor installations are spring and fall. When these times of year arrive, weather is moderate, promoting plant growth and permitting simpler implementation. Summer heat and winter cold can obstruct work and plant vitality.
